Practical Sewing-Cover stitch

Edges with elastic

Stitch length: 3-4
Differential: 0.7-N
- Sew on elastic with 4-thread overlock.
- Turn the raw edge to the width of the elastic and top stitch from the right
side.
Guide the fold along the right section of the foot or use one of the lines on
the stitch plate as a guide.
The hem is stretchy, durable and regains its shape after stretching.
Ideal for swimwear, gymwear, children's clothing, skirt and trouser waist-
bands.

Binding

Stitch length : 3-4
Differential: N
Cut bias binding or bias cut strips to the desired width, mark if wanted and
press or pin.
Lay the binding round the fabric edge and sew.
Guide the edge of the binding on the right of the fabric along the left side
section of the foot.
The edge of the binding on the wrong side(raw edge) is neatened by the
looper thread.
Trim surplus binding close to stitches.
Ideal for neck edges on stretch fabrics, arm-holes and finishes on tubular
items.
